Countdown Begins To Beverley Festival

June 1, 2011

Over the weekend of 17-19 June, Beverley Folk, Acoustic and Roots Festival rolls into town, bringing with it an eclectic mix of performers and visitors. Beverley Leisure Centre is again the heart of the festival, but pubs and other venues in the town will also enjoy their own special atmospheres as musicians and aficionados enjoy each others company. Film Club @ Beverley Festival

May 20, 2011

For the first time ever, Beverley Folk Acoustic and Roots Festival will include film as part of the weekend of entertainment. Launched in partnership with the Beverley Film Society, the Film Club will screen four folk-themed films over the weekend of the Beverley Festival from Friday 17 June to Sunday 19 June.
